#1269b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1269b4 is composed of 7.1% red, 41.2%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 41.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 207.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 38.8%. #1269b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#24d2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1269b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1269b4 has RGB values of R:18, G:105,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 1206708.

Shades and Tints of #1269b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eff7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1269b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6368 is the less saturated color, while #036ac3 is the most saturated one.
